What is Laser Cutting?
Laser cutting is one of the best fabrication methods that is used across different industries. It is a machining process that uses a high-energy beam to cut any material. Laser full form is Light Amplification by Stimulated Emission of Radiation. The laser cutting technology allows for precise and detailed cuts through materials, delivering a smooth and accurate finish. The laser beams pierce through the metal with a hole at the edge, and the beam continues melting the material it runs through.
Types of Lasers
There are three main categories in industrial laser cutting systems, namely:
- Gas Lasers: This is one of the most popular laser cutting technologies. This method uses a carbon dioxide-mixed laser. It is ideal for cutting through metals or engraving materials.
- Crystal Lasers: In this method, crystal mediums are used for advanced cutting capabilities, allowing for the fabrication of metals & non-metal materials.
- Fiber Lasers: The fiber laser cutting method is a new cutting technology for a better-focused laser beam through fiber optics. This method is more suitable for cutting through heavier & tougher material.
What Materials Can Be Cut With Laser Cutting?
Some of the materials that can be cut with a laser cutter are:
Metals
Laser cutting machines are the best industrial cutting tools for metal machinability. It is used to make incisions on different types of metals. Some of the most common alloys and metals that can be cut with laser cutting are steel (carbon steel, mild steel, stainless steel), aluminium, copper, brass, tungsten, nickel, etc.
Plastics
Knowing what types of plastics can be cut with laser cutting is crucial. This is because plastic releases toxic fumes when heated at high temperatures. Some of the plastics suitable for laser cutting are polypropylene, acrylics, PMMA, polycarbonate, POM, polyethylene, polyester, etc.
Wood
Laser cutting is ideal for wood cutting as it works great on all types of wood. It can be used for laser engraving on wood and other processes. The only aspect to consider is the thickness of the wood; ensure the wood is up to 20mm thick. Some of the woods that laser cutting is suitable for are all types of hardwood, softwood, and plywood.
Glass

Some of the materials that are not suitable for laser cutting are fiberglass, ABS, PVC & Vinyl, HDPE, and polypropylene foam.
